Transaction 110c53624295dfa44d52fb3f9b798476ef5b90fb1abc64a60039ea2abac09e61

2 Input
1 Outputs
  • 110c53624295dfa44d52fb3f9b798476ef5b90fb1abc64a60039ea2abac09e61:0
  • value  475796
    address  18SMesfzqkSakxbhzH514LK49gQ8pJ7mYg